T&T’s sprint queen Michelle-Lee Ahye has qualified for the semi-final of the Women’s 100-metres event at the Tokyo Olympics.
Running out of lane 6 in heat number 7, just after midnight last night, Ahye clocked in a time of 11.06 seconds ahead of Jamaica’s Shericka Jackson in 11.07.
The top three qualified for the semi-final.
Earlier, fellow T&T female 100 metre sprinter Kelly-Ann Baptiste ran in heat number 2, but finished 6th in a time of 11.48 seconds.
That race was won by Elaine Thompson-Herah of Jamaica in 10.82.
